본문 바로가기

자기계발/Immersive Content

패스트캠퍼스 챌린지 19일차(지역변수, 분기형, 반복문)

[누구나 가능한 VR/AR 콘텐츠제작 올인원 패키지 Online]

 

더보기

Ch 04. 기초문법 - 05. 프로그램 제어하기2 - 1

Ch 04. 기초문법 - 06. 프로그램 제어하기2 - 2

 

05. 프로그램 제어하기2 - 1


ㅇ지역변수

-{} 코드 블록 내부에서 선언되어, 블록 외부에서는 사용 불가함

-소스코드 전반적으로 적용되는 규칙임

 

 

ㅁ분기문(branch) - if

-조건이 참인 경우/ 거짓인 경우 서로 다른 결과값으로 분기함

if(조건식){         } -> 조건식이 true면, 다음 항을 실행해라

if(조건식){      } else {     }

 

if(조건식){      } else  if(     ){     } else {     }

 

042_Operator_Branch

042_Operator_Branch

 

 

043_Operator_Branch2

 

044_Operator_Branch3 : true인 세 가지 조건문만 실행됨

 

05. 프로그램 제어하기2 - 2


 

ㅇ분기형 (branch) - switch

-조건이 많은 경우

-쓰는 법:

switch(   )

{case(조건) : (결과) break;

case(조건) : (결과) break;)}

-case가 해당되면 바로 break(끝)

int 선언과 할당을 합친 코드 연습 / *선언은 한 번만
branch switch의 또 다른 예제

ㅇ반복문 - for / while / do ~ while / 중첩 for

-while (조건식) { 반복되는 코드 } : 조건식이 맞으면 코드 무한 반복, 틀리면 실행 안함

-do { 반복되는 코드 } while (조건식); : 반드시 한 번은 코드 실행, 조건이 맞으면 무한 반복

-for (초기식; 조건식; 증감식) { 반복되는 코드 } : 1)초기식이 조건에 맞으면 코드 실행, 2)증감식이 조건에 맞으면 코드 실행 3) 2 반복 

-for( ; ; ) {for( ; ; ) { ... } } : 최상위는 하위의 식이 False가 되어 빠져나올 때까지 동일반복 됨

 

047_Operator_while 예제

 

 

 

049_Operator_for

 

 

050_Operator_for_for

 

배우면 바뀐다 패스트캠퍼스>>> https://bit.ly/37BpXiC

 

패스트캠퍼스 [직장인 실무교육]

프로그래밍, 영상편집, UX/UI, 마케팅, 데이터 분석, 엑셀강의, The RED, 국비지원, 기업교육, 서비스 제공.

fastcampus.co.kr

본 포스팅은 패스트캠퍼스 환급 챌린지 참여를 위해 작성되었습니다.